You can track your lost device with the IMEI number, the IMEI number is a unique 15-digit number that is assigned to every mobile phone. Once you lost your device in somewhere, you can try to use the IMEI number to track your lost phone using a variety of methods, including:

  • IMEI tracking websites: There are a number of websites that allow you to track your lost phone using its IMEI number. These websites typically work by connecting to the phone’s cellular network and providing you with its location.
  • IMEI tracking apps: There are also a number of apps that allow you to track your lost phone using its IMEI number. These apps typically work by connecting to the phone’s GPS and providing you with its location.
  • IMEI tracking services: There are also a number of services that allow you to track your lost phone using its IMEI number. These services typically work by connecting to the phone’s cellular network and GPS and providing you with its location.

It is important to note that IMEI tracking is not always accurate. The accuracy of IMEI tracking depends on a number of factors, including the strength of the cellular signal and the location of the phone. In addition, IMEI tracking can only be used to track a phone that is turned on and connected to the cellular network.

If you have lost your mobile phone, the first thing you should do is to contact your mobile phone carrier. Your carrier may be able to block the phone’s SIM card and prevent it from being used. You should also report your phone as lost to the police. The police may be able to track down your phone and recover it for you.

Here are some tips for preventing your mobile phone from being lost or stolen:

  • Keep your phone in a safe place: When you are not using your phone, keep it in a safe place, such as a pocket or bag.
  • Use a passcode or fingerprint scanner: A passcode or fingerprint scanner will help to prevent unauthorized access to your phone.
  • Enable two-factor authentication: Two-factor authentication adds an extra layer of security to your phone by requiring you to enter a code from your phone in addition to your password when you log in to your account.
  • Keep your software up to date: Software updates often include security patches that can help to protect your phone from malware and other attacks.
  • Be careful about what information you share: Do not share your personal information, such as your address or phone number, with people you do not know.

By following these tips, you can help to keep your mobile phone safe and secure.
